As per the definition, any group of genus bacteria that has a rod-shaped body with a non-spore-forming feature and is gram-positive in nature is called lactobacillus bacteria. This genus of bacteria can convert glucose into lactic acid as a by-product of its metabolism. You can find the presence of this bacterium in wide sources such as animal feeds, manure, silage, milk, milk products, etc.
The name ‘lactobacillus’ is given as it produces lactic acid during the fermentation process of carbohydrates. It also has a rod-shaped which is why it is termed as bacillus. It is one of the friendly bacteria that are present in human physiology and help in digestion. 1. What are the key characteristics of Lactobacillus bacteria?
Lactobacillus is a genus of bacteria known for several key characteristics. They are gram-positive, meaning they have a thick peptidoglycan cell wall. Morphologically, they are rod-shaped (bacillus) and are non-spore-forming. They are facultative anaerobes or microaerophilic, capable of thriving in low-oxygen environments, and are primarily known for their role in fermentation, especially converting sugars like lactose into lactic acid.
2. How does Lactobacillus convert milk into curd?
Lactobacillus, often referred to as Lactic Acid Bacteria (LAB), converts milk into curd through fermentation. A small amount of curd is added to milk as a starter or inoculum, which contains millions of LAB. These bacteria multiply and metabolise the milk sugar, lactose, converting it into lactic acid. This acid lowers the pH of the milk, causing the milk protein, casein, to coagulate and partially digest, resulting in the thick texture of curd. This process also improves its nutritional quality by increasing Vitamin B12.
3. What is the role of Lactobacillus in maintaining human gut health?
Lactobacillus plays a crucial role in maintaining a healthy gut microbiome. As a beneficial bacterium, it helps in several ways:
It prevents the growth of harmful, disease-causing microbes by competing for nutrients and producing antimicrobial substances.
It aids in the digestion of food and absorption of nutrients.
It contributes to the synthesis of certain vitamins, such as Vitamin B12 and Vitamin K.
It helps strengthen the gut barrier, preventing harmful substances from entering the bloodstream.
4. What are the main commercial uses of Lactobacillus bacteria?
Lactobacillus is used extensively in various industries due to its fermentation capabilities. Its main commercial applications include:
Dairy Industry: For the production of curd, yoghurt, cheese, and buttermilk.
Food Production: Used in fermenting vegetables for making pickles, sauerkraut, and kimchi. It is also a key component in making sourdough bread.
Pharmaceuticals: It is a primary ingredient in probiotics, which are supplements designed to restore and maintain healthy gut flora.
5. Why is Lactobacillus considered a probiotic?
Lactobacillus is considered a probiotic because it fits the definition of live microorganisms that, when administered in adequate amounts, confer a health benefit on the host. It provides these benefits by improving the balance of the gut microbiome. By colonising the intestine, it helps to inhibit the growth of pathogenic bacteria, enhances the body's immune response, and improves digestion, thereby actively promoting overall gut health.
6. How does the function of Lactobacillus in cheese-making differ from curd-making?
While both processes involve fermentation, the role of Lactobacillus and other microbes differs. In curd-making, Lactobacillus is primarily used to sour the milk and coagulate protein to form a simple, fresh product. In cheese-making, specific strains of Lactobacillus (along with other bacteria and sometimes fungi) are used not only for initial coagulation but also for the subsequent ripening process. This ripening stage is crucial as it develops the characteristic flavour, texture, and aroma of different cheese varieties, which can take weeks, months, or even years.
7. Can Lactobacillus ever be harmful to humans?
For the vast majority of people, Lactobacillus is not only safe but highly beneficial. It is a natural part of the human microbiome. However, in extremely rare circumstances, particularly in individuals who are severely immunocompromised (e.g., those with critical illnesses or certain genetic disorders), some species of Lactobacillus can act as opportunistic pathogens and may cause infections. For the general healthy population, its consumption in foods like curd and yoghurt is considered completely safe and healthy.
